How Roy Lee Jackson's Played Outs Compares to Similar Players

Roy Lee Jackson totaled 1,677 career Played Outs, well below the league average of 6,515.6 — production that significantly underperformed against league baselines. His best Played Outs season came in 1982, posting 291, well below the league average of 1,113.2 that year. The lowest point came in 1978 at 38, well below the league average of 1,150.2 that year.
